Ceramic Tableware Market Size
The global ceramic tableware market size was estimated at USD 12.4 billion in 2024. The market is expected to grow from USD 13 billion in 2025 to USD 22.2 billion in 2034 at a CAGR of 7%. The high production costs pose a significant hurdle for the ceramic tableware market since they greatly affect the profit margins as well as the pricing structure. Production of ceramic tableware is particularly energy intensive due to the firing of clay in high-temperature kilns. The energy costs are escalating all over the globe, especially in regions that are resource deficient, and this increases operational expenditure.
Increased wages in many countries also raises the costs of qualified laborers needed for the skilled tasks of molding, glazing, and quality control. Such tasks are essential to the manufacturing process. The expenses incurred for acquiring raw materials further compound the costs. Good quality clay, glazes, and other materials for making attractive and sturdy pieces of tableware for simple products can be expensive, rarer still when crafting premium products with certain sought after attributes.

Ceramic Tableware Market Analysis
Based on type, the market is segmented as Dinnerware, Cookware, Beverageware, Serveware and Others (Flatware, Cutley, etc.). In 2024, the Dinnerware segment generated a revenue of USD 5.2 billion and is expected to grow at a CAGR of around 7.6% during the forecast period.
Based on shape, the ceramic tableware market is segmented as round, square, rectangular. In 2024, the round segment accounted for over 45.8% and is expected to grow at the rate of 7.5% till 2034.
Based on material, the ceramic tableware market is segmented as Earthware, Stoneware, Porcelains and Bone China. The porcelain segment is expected to hold a major share of 44.7% in 2024.

Ceramic Tableware Market Companies
Churchill China PLC is a well-known UK-based producer of high-quality ceramic tableware. The firm is highly respected for its long-lasting and attractive products, serving both the hospitality sector and retail markets. With an emphasis on innovation and craftsmanship, Churchill produces a broad variety of dinnerware, mugs, and custom ceramic products. The firm is committed to sustainability in its production processes and has a strong global presence.
Arabia is a Finnish ceramics company renowned for its superior craftsmanship in producing high-quality tableware and cookware. The firm is dedicated to ceramic products with ageless designs, emphasizing durability and functionality. Arabia collections tend to include traditional patterns and contemporary styles, suiting both traditional and modern tastes. The company is admired for its sustainability efforts, employing eco-friendly materials and environmentally friendly production methods.
